Questions Asked in 2023-24
Fundamentals Of Mechanical Engineering (BME101) — complete question paper · 70 marks · 3 Hours
- aWrite the characteristics of force
- bWhat do you mean by shear strain?
- cDescribe weakness of hybrid vehicles
- dWhat do you understand by total cylinder volume?
- eA pressure of 2000 Pa is transmitted throughout a liquid colum n due to a force being applied on a piston. If the piston has an area of 0.1 m 2, what force is applied?
- fGive example for a low head, medium head and high head turbine
- gGive the names of types of transducers based on quantity to be measured
- aA metallic wire (Y = 20 × 10 10 N/m². and σ = 0.26) of length 3 m and diameter 0.1 cm is stretched by a load of 10 kg. Calculate the decrease in diameter of the wire
- bExplain the working of two stroke petrol engine with diagram
- cExplain the following: (i) DPT (ii) Comfort Conditions (iii) Specific Humidity
- dDraw velocity triangle diagram for Pelton Wheel turbine. Diff erentiate between the turbines and pumps
- eDescribe the construction and operation of a Prony brake dynam ometer. And Derive the formula for break power of engine
- aA beam 8 m. long is hinged at A and supported on roller over a smooth surface inclined at an angle 30 0 to the horizontal at B. The beam is loaded as shown in fig. Determine the support reactions
- bWhat is the shape of cross-section obtained after yielding in c ases of brittle material? Explain in brief
- aWhy an energy management control system is required in an HEV? Do you think an elaborate energy management system similar to that app lied to a hybrid vehicle, is required in an electric vehicle? Explain
- bGive the types of energy storag e technologies suitable for hybr id electric vehicle. Explain the lithium-ion batteries in detail
- aWith a neat sketch, explain the working principle of vapour com pression Refrigeration system. Also draw T-s and P-h diagram
- bA cold storage is to maintained at -5 o C while the surroundings are at 35 o C. The heat leakage from the surroundings into the cold storage is estimated to be 29 kW. The actual C.O.P. of the refrigeration plants is one-thi rd of an ideal plant working between some temperatures. Find the power require d to drive the plant
- aWater flows through a pipe of inte rnal diameter 20cm at the spe ed of 1m/s. What should the diameter of the nozzle be if the water is to emerge at the speed of 4m/s? By continuity equation
- bHow does temperature affect the viscosity of a fluid? A square plate 0.1 m side moves parallel to second plate with a velocity of 0.1 ms−1, bot h plates being immersed in water. If the viscous force is 0.002 N and the coef ficient of viscosity 0.001 poise, what is the distance between the plates?
- aExplain with neat sketch optical pyrometer. Explain why an optical pyrometer for measuring high temperatures calibrated for an ideal blackbo dy radiation gives too low a value for the temperature of a red-hot iron pie ce in the open
